/* Tuple object interface */
 | 
						|
 | 
						|
/*
 | 
						|
Another generally useful object type is an tuple of object pointers.
 | 
						|
This is a mutable type: the tuple items can be changed (but not their
 | 
						|
number).  Out-of-range indices or non-tuple objects are ignored.
 | 
						|
 | 
						|
*** WARNING *** PyTuple_SetItem does not increment the new item's reference
 | 
						|
count, but does decrement the reference count of the item it replaces,
 | 
						|
if not nil.  It does *decrement* the reference count if it is *not*
 | 
						|
inserted in the tuple.  Similarly, PyTuple_GetItem does not increment the
 | 
						|
returned item's reference count.
 | 
						|
*/
